YouTube - Voice Replies for Comments

YouTube is testing a new feature that lets creators reply to comments with voice messages. This feature aims to improve how creators interact with their viewers.

Currently, it is available only to a small group of creators in the United States.

How It Works

Creators can use this feature by clicking on a sound wave icon when they respond to comments. They can then record their voice and post it as a reply.

Viewers can listen to these voice replies just like any other comment. There is also an option for a transcript, which shows the text of the voice message.

Current Limitations

  • Availability: The feature is only for iOS users and only for creators who are part of the test group.
  • Comments: Creators can only reply with voice messages on their own videos.
  • Interaction: All viewers can listen to and engage with these voice replies.

YouTube hopes this new feature will help build stronger connections between creators and their audiences, similar to how TikTok allows video replies.

This change may lead to more personal interactions in the comment section.
